Description

Description

“When I find myself in times of trouble
Mother Mary comes to me
Speaking words of wisdom
Let it be”
When I’m down and upset
I’ll sing the Beatles golden hit, “Let it be” from Lady Madonna
Its “Forget it” in Cantonese, or “My condolences”, or “Whatever will be, will be”…
For the Buddhist, it is “Let go”
For Western pop song wisdom, it is “Don’t Let Me Down”
Eastern political truth in singing, Come Together
One country two systems, Let It Be
Let It Be
Let It Be
Let It Be
